#aeeb95 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#aeeb95 is composed of 68.2% red, 92.2%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.6%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 102.6 degrees, a saturation of 68.3% and a lightness of 75.3%. #aeeb95 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5dd72b.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

Shades and Tints of #aeeb95

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a02 is the darkest color, while #fafef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#aeeb95

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bec4bc is the less saturated color, while #a6fe82 is the most saturated one.
